10 August 1994 Stimulated Raman backscatter from short laser pulses in plasmas
Nikolai E. Andreev, L. M. Gorbunov

Abstract
The basic equations are formulated to study the selfconsistent space-time evolution of a intense ultrashort laser pulse and near-backward stimulated Raman scattered radiation. The analytic theory and numerical results are presented for spectra and intensities of scattered radiation produced by a laser pulse with a given form. A simple criterion is found for the weak influence of stimulated Raman backscattering (SRBS) on a pulse propagation. A few results of numerical simulations, showing the temporal evolution of SRBS spectrum by laser pulse propagation, are presented.
